Clarifies what buildings constitute an existing public school building for purposes of the location of charter schools
Summary
Clarifies what buildings constitute an existing public school building for purposes of the location of charter schools by describing an existing public school building as being a building that is currently occupied or is unoccupied but designated for potential school use.
